Residual current device with overcurrent release 4P 6kA C 20A/30mA A QC/QB ADM470QC
Comprehensive electrical circuit protection
The ADM470QC residual current circuit breaker with overcurrent protection is an advanced protective device that combines functions of protection against overloads, short circuits, and leakage currents in one compact unit. Thanks to its 4-pole design and Type C tripping characteristic, it is ideal for three-phase applications requiring high reliability.
Design and electrical parameters
The device provides a rated short-circuit breaking capacity Icn of 6 kA in accordance with the EN 61009-1 standard, guaranteeing effective protection even during strong short-circuit currents. A rated insulation voltage Ui of 500 V and a rated impulse withstand voltage Uimp of 4 kV ensure safe operation in installations with increased insulation requirements.
A rated current In = 20 A combined with a rated residual operating current Idn = 30 mA creates an optimal configuration for most lighting and socket circuits. Type A sensitivity enables the detection of both sinusoidal and pulsating unidirectional DC currents, which is particularly important for modern electronic loads.
Connection system and mounting
The design utilizes the QuickConnect system, which allows for fast and secure wire connections from both the top and bottom. Cross-sections for connected solid wires range from 1 to 25 mm², while stranded wires range from 1 to 16 mm², ensuring versatility of application.
The device is mounted on a standard DIN rail, occupying 4 module widths (71 mm) with a mounting depth of only 70 mm. This compact design allows for efficient use of space in modular distribution boards.
Operating and environmental parameters
The breaker maintains full functionality across a wide ambient temperature range from -25°C to +40°C, enabling use in both unheated rooms and industrial installations. The IP20 protection rating ensures safety against access to hazardous parts.
An energy limitation class of I²t = 3 and pollution degree II confirm high manufacturing quality and suitability for demanding applications. Total power loss of 11.7 W at the rated current demonstrates the energy efficiency of the design.
Normative compliance and safety
The device meets the requirements of the EN 61009-1 standard, confirming its safety of use and compatibility with European electrical installation standards. The design also takes into account the requirements for overvoltage category III and instantaneous tripping characteristics, ensuring an immediate response to emergency states.
